Tylenol Overdose? Act Fast – Talk to a Doctor Now!

Taking 23,500 mg of Tylenol (acetaminophen) is a dangerously high dose and can cause severe liver damage, even if you’re not experiencing symptoms yet. Acetaminophen toxicity can sometimes have a delayed onset, and serious liver failure can develop over time.
